Output ef0618d32ed4e893d3c7f17c18b983f4cb769ef67355d2e04fdbc881368e906f:1

value
681825829
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93f15df02b0a09a6e812ed4f651cb5b009d9cdaf OP_EQUALVERIFY OP_CHECKSIG
address
1EVFUfmmbC4zbtuU1z5zBks5Nm5bYNuLig
transaction
ef0618d32ed4e893d3c7f17c18b983f4cb769ef67355d2e04fdbc881368e906f
confirmations
388127
spent
true